In 1470, Matthew Smyth entered the world in Aylburton, Gloucestershire, England, born to John Smyth And Joan Hoper. Matthew Smyth married Alice Havard John, and had children including Elizabeth Smythe Smith, Sir John Smythe Lord High Sheriff Of Essex Assistant To Henry Viii Surveyor To Jane Seymour. Matthew Smyth passed away in 1526 in Bristol, Bristol Unitary Authority, Bristol, England.
